Annabergite - nickel arsenate hydrate - presents a green colour almost unique within the mineralogical world. As a very rare species it never forms large crystals, but it can be stunningly beautiful when it produces extensive coverage of star-like sprays of intensely coloured bladed crystals. Widely regarded as the world's best locality for the species, the Km 3 mines at Lavrion Mining District, Greece have not only produced the largest crystals, but also the best colour. This very large miniature specimen features the finest intense apple-green colour in really sharply defined bladed monoclinic microcrystals. These crystals reach 2 mm in length and sprays to 4 mm in diameter and are stunningly beautiful under magnification.
